Les Chartes De La Tour De Douvres (1250-1624): Documents Pour Servir À L'histoire Du Bas-bugey Et Des Provinces Voisines... presents a detailed collection of charters related to the Dover Tower, spanning from 1250 to 1624. Authored by Frédéric Marchand, this historical work serves as a valuable resource for understanding the history of the Bas-Bugey region and neighboring provinces during the medieval and early modern periods. The book meticulously compiles and presents historical documents, providing insights into the legal, social, and political landscape of the time. Researchers and historians interested in French history, medieval studies, and the Bugey region will find this collection an essential resource.
